Transaction acdf3c26caefbcf7451f1c1a1f04294709552dfed98bb8e5c026a8ceaf43afbe

2 Input
2 Outputs
  • acdf3c26caefbcf7451f1c1a1f04294709552dfed98bb8e5c026a8ceaf43afbe:0
  • value  20608718
    address  34b8chm1V4sfnNU4RxGppptfYnwTvmrzq7
  • acdf3c26caefbcf7451f1c1a1f04294709552dfed98bb8e5c026a8ceaf43afbe:1
  • value  5293402
    address  1FMSrMhqCrJ9DtS5Mh21origDMhySfN5Jx